top of page
Summer Photo 3.jpg

Elkhorn Lodge

B&B Investment opportunity located in Banff National Park


Elkhorn Lodge, A Premier Investment Opportunity in Banff National Park

Introducing an extraordinary investment opportunity in the heart of Banff National Park: Elkhorn Lodge. Nestled amidst the breathtaking beauty of Banff, this establishment attracts visitors from around the world seeking an unforgettable experience in nature’s embrace. This enchanting property offers a range of delightful guest accommodations comprising 4 cabins/suites each with its own kitchenette, plus an additional 4 guest rooms with private bathrooms, all complimented by a spacious 2 bedroom managers suite. (Total 10 bedrooms, 10 bathrooms, 5 kitchenettes). With it’s prime location, generous grounds (27,738 sqft) and proximity to renowned attractions, the Elkhorn Lodge is poised to captivate both leisure and adventure-seeking guests. Immerse yourself in the allure of Banff’s thriving tourism industry by acquiring this remarkable business, an idyllic getaway to owning a piece of this awe-inspiring mountain paradise.

Photo portfolio



Banff National Park

Floor plan

Like what you see?

Summer Photo 3.jpg
bottom of page